In some regions of the UK waiting times for ADHD evaluations can be very long. I obtained the most recent data through Freedom of Information requests. Patients had to wait up to four years before getting an appointment. This is a significant increase when compared to earlier figures. The longest wait time for an appointment was at Cwm Taf Morgannwg University Health Board. They waited for 182 weeks.

To be officially diagnosed with ADHD you need to consult a psychiatrist or an ADHD specialist nurse. Specialists in psychiatry and ADHD nurses have been through specialized training on the condition. Other mental health professionals, like counsellors, aren't able to diagnose ADHD.
